Restudy of malformations of the internal auditory meatus, cochlear nerve canal and cochlear nerve
The present study aims to restudy the correlation between the internal auditory meatus (IAM), the cochlear nerve canal (CNC), the cochlear nerve (CN) and inner ear malformations.
